DF62
Data Storage (DS) ODS InfoData Storage ODS Info is a single control byte describing the card's own on-device data-storage options within Kernel 2's data-storage feature - the card-side declaration that its sibling, DS ODS Term (DF63, covered alongside it here), answers from the terminal's side. Together the two form the same declare-and-supply pattern already seen repeatedly throughout this dictionary for other capability-and-content pairs: DF62 states what the card's storage supports, DF63 is the terminal-supplied value actually written into it. It's also related to the Requested Operator ID (9F5C, covered earlier), since which specific ODS Info options are even meaningful depends on which data-storage operator program is active for a given transaction. Because its exact bit-level content is scheme-specific rather than detailed in this entry, a terminal implementing on-device storage against DF62 needs the relevant scheme's own documentation to interpret it correctly, in the same pattern already established for the Terminal Risk Management Data (9F1D) and the protected/unprotected envelope families covered earlier. See EMV Contactless Book C-2.

Properties
| Tag | DF62 |
|---|---|
| Name | Data Storage (DS) ODS Info |
| Format | Binary |
| Length | 1 bytes |
| Source | Card (ICC) |
| Templates | — |
| Books | EMV Contactless Book C-2 |
